Как увеличить размер файла — эффективные методы для достижения большего объема информации

Когда речь идет о файле, часто нас интересует его размер. В некоторых случаях небольшой объем файла — это то, что мы ищем, чтобы быстро передать или отправить его по электронной почте. Однако есть и иные ситуации, когда нужно увеличить размер файла. Например, если мы создаем видео или сводку данных, мы, вероятно, хотим увеличить объем файла и сохранить все детали. Для этого существуют различные методы, способные эффективно увеличить размер файла без потери качества.

Один из способов увеличить размер файла — это использование изображений высокого разрешения. Например, если вы создаете презентацию или печатный материал, вам может понадобиться изображение с большим количеством пикселей на дюйм. Такое изображение будет занимать больше места на диске, но вы сможете достичь более четкого и детализированного изображения.

Также, чтобы увеличить размер файла, можно использовать методы сжатия данных. Это особенно полезно, когда речь идет о файле с текстом или таблицей. Сжатие данных позволяет уменьшить размер файла, сохраняя при этом все его содержимое. Например, при сжатии текстового документа удаляются повторяющиеся символы или комментарии, что позволяет значительно сократить размер файла.

Другим эффективным способом увеличения размера файла является добавление большего объема информации. Например, если у вас есть аудиофайл, вы можете добавить дополнительное звуковое сопровождение или фоновую музыку. Это позволит не только увеличить размер файла, но и сделать его более интересным и захватывающим для слушателя.

Оптимизация кода для увеличения размера файла

Оптимизация кода позволяет увеличить размер файла без значительного увеличения его объема. Вот некоторые эффективные способы оптимизации кода для увеличения размера файла:

  1. Удаление дублирующихся символов и строк: проверьте код на наличие повторяющихся элементов, таких как повторяющиеся фрагменты кода или неиспользуемые переменные. Удалите все дубликаты для сокращения размера кода.
  2. Сжатие кода: используйте сжатие файлов с помощью специальных инструментов или сервисов. Сжатие помогает уменьшить объем кода без ущерба для его функциональности.
  3. Минификация CSS и JavaScript: минификация позволяет уменьшить размер файлов CSS и JavaScript путем удаления пробелов, комментариев и лишних символов. Это помогает сэкономить пропускную способность сети и ускорить загрузку страницы.
  4. Оптимизация изображений: выберите подходящий формат изображения (например, JPEG или PNG) и оптимизируйте его сжатие. Используйте инструменты для сокращения размера файла изображения, не ухудшая его качество.
  5. Использование кэширования: настройте кэширование файлов на стороне сервера и клиента, чтобы повторные запросы к страницам использовали закэшированные версии файлов. Это сокращает объем передаваемых данных и улучшает скорость загрузки страницы.

Применение этих методов оптимизации кода поможет увеличить размер файла без заметного влияния на его производительность и время загрузки. Однако, важно находить баланс между увеличением размера файла и его оптимизацией для достижения наилучших результатов.

Использование сжатия данных для увеличения объема файла

Существует несколько алгоритмов сжатия данных, которые могут быть использованы для увеличения объема файла. Один из наиболее распространенных алгоритмов — алгоритм сжатия ZIP. Он позволяет упаковать файлы в архив и сжать их с использованием различных методов сжатия, таких как DEFLATE или LZ77. Это обеспечивает оптимальное сжатие и сохраняет данные в архиве.

Другие алгоритмы сжатия данных включают GZIP и BZIP2. GZIP используется для сжатия одиночных файлов или потоков данных, в то время как BZIP2 предлагает более высокую степень сжатия за счет использования сложных алгоритмов.

Вместе с алгоритмами сжатия данных также важно учитывать формат файла. Например, изображения можно сжать с использованием алгоритма сжатия изображений, таких как JPEG или PNG. Это позволяет значительно уменьшить размер файла изображения без потери его качества.

При использовании сжатия данных для увеличения объема файла необходимо также учитывать, что процесс сжатия может повлиять на скорость доступа к файлу. Более сложные алгоритмы сжатия могут требовать больше времени для сжатия и разжатия файла, что может повлиять на производительность.

Важно отметить, что использование сжатия данных может быть полезным при передаче файлов по сети, особенно если есть ограничения на скорость передачи данных или доступное место хранения. Однако, при использовании этого метода, необходимо внимательно выбирать алгоритм сжатия в зависимости от типа данных и требуемого качества.

Использование сжатия данных является эффективным методом увеличения объема файла. Однако, необходимо учитывать различные алгоритмы сжатия данных, формат файла и возможные последствия для производительности при применении этого метода.

Инкапсуляция ресурсов для увеличения размера файла

Примерами ресурсов, которые можно инкапсулировать в файле, являются изображения, скрипты, стили, шрифты и другие. Как правило, все эти файлы загружаются отдельно, что замедляет процесс загрузки страницы. Однако, при использовании инкапсуляции ресурсов, все эти файлы объединяются в один файл, что уменьшает количество запросов к серверу и ускоряет загрузку страницы.

Один из способов инкапсуляции ресурсов – это использование специальных инструментов и технологий, таких как Webpack, Gulp, Grunt и другие. Эти инструменты позволяют объединять и минифицировать файлы, а также оптимизировать работу с ресурсами. Например, при использовании Webpack можно создавать модули, которые содержат в себе все необходимые ресурсы, включая изображения, стили и скрипты. Такой подход позволяет сократить количество запросов и сделать сайт более быстрым и отзывчивым.

Также при инкапсуляции ресурсов можно использовать методы сжатия, чтобы уменьшить размер файлов и улучшить их производительность. Например, сжатие изображений позволяет сократить их объем, не снижая качество, что приводит к увеличению скорости загрузки страницы. Также можно применять сжатие для CSS и JavaScript файлов, чтобы сократить их размер. Для этого можно использовать различные инструменты и плагины, такие как Gzip или Brotli.

Таким образом, инкапсуляция ресурсов является эффективным методом увеличения размера файла для достижения большего объема информации. Этот подход позволяет улучшить производительность сайта, сократить время загрузки страницы и повысить пользовательский опыт.

Применение эффективного кодирования для увеличения объема файла

Для увеличения объема файла существует несколько методов, в том числе применение эффективного кодирования. Это один из самых популярных и эффективных способов достичь большего объема без увеличения количества информации.

Эффективное кодирование позволяет использовать более компактные представления данных, благодаря чему файлы занимают меньше места на диске и передаются быстрее по сети. Однако, при таком подходе возможна потеря некоторой информации, поэтому важно выбирать подходящий метод кодирования в зависимости от типа данных и требований к точности восстановления.

Один из таких методов — алгоритм сжатия данных. При использовании данного метода файлы сначала сжимаются, а затем — распаковываются в исходное состояние при необходимости. Существуют различные алгоритмы сжатия, такие как Huffman, Lempel-Ziv и другие, которые позволяют достигнуть высокой степени сжатия без значительной потери качества данных.

Еще один метод эффективного кодирования — использование специализированных форматов файлов, таких как XML или JSON. Эти форматы позволяют использовать более компактные представления данных, благодаря структурированному подходу к хранению информации. Кроме того, существуют специальные библиотеки и алгоритмы для работы с такими форматами, которые помогают увеличить производительность при обработке и передаче файлов.

Важно отметить, что при применении эффективного кодирования необходимо учитывать особенности конкретной задачи и требования к файлу. Некоторые методы могут быть более эффективными для определенных типов данных, а другие — для других. Поэтому рекомендуется провести тестирование различных методов и выбрать наиболее подходящий вариант.

В итоге, применение эффективного кодирования является важным аспектом увеличения объема файла. Этот подход позволяет достичь большего объема без увеличения количества информации, что является важным фактором при работе со большими файлами и ограниченными ресурсами.

Оцените статью